Chemical & Physical Properties
| Density | 1.0±0.1 g/cm3 |
|---|---|
| Boiling Point | 276.2±3.0 °C at 760 mmHg |
| Melting Point | −11-−9 °C(lit.) |
| Molecular Formula | C12H25Br |
| Molecular Weight | 249.231 |
| Flash Point | 113.0±10.0 °C |
| Exact Mass | 248.113953 |
| LogP | 6.99 |
| Vapour density | 8.6 (vs air) |
| Vapour Pressure | 0.0±0.5 mmHg at 25°C |
| Index of Refraction | 1.458 |
| InChIKey | PBLNBZIONSLZBU-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
| SMILES | CCCCCCCCCCCCBr |
| Stability | Stable. Combustible.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ents, strong bases. |
| Water Solubility | insoluble |
